Subject: DR drill results — Parityscope rate checker. Team, Friday's disaster-recovery drill for the Parityscope hotel rate-parity checker went cleanly: failover to the Dunmere region completed in eleven minutes, and scrape queues resumed without data loss. One gap for future maintainers: the secrets cache does not replicate, so after any regional failover you must re-initialize it by hand. Do so using the recovery passphrase below.

unlock words, fahop-yageg: ralwyn-kelath

Ticket: Pop-up office access — Hallenfair Expo, Stand 14

Hi contractors — thanks for helping rig the Tindervale pop-up office at the fair. Build hours are 06:00–09:00 before the halls open, so please arrive early and wear your hi-vis on the show floor. Tools stay in the lockable crate overnight; nothing left on the stand, please. The back door of the pop-up unit has a keypad lock — let yourselves in with the code below.

turnstile pass: bdg-YPPQB-52010

**Ticket GRID-418: Crossword generator pointed at wrong environment**

The Lattervane crossword generator in staging is pulling its word list from the production Clueforge index, which explains why unreleased themed puzzles appeared in internal previews yesterday. Please update `LV_INDEX_HOST` to the staging endpoint and confirm the generator's cache is flushed afterward, since stale grids persist for up to an hour. Access to the staging index is authenticated, so the env file also needs the credential on the line below.

secret setting of yafof-tawep: RELAY_SECRET8=8abb5772

Onboarding — Fernwick profile store. Profiles are sharded by user ID hash across 32 Quillbase nodes. Resharding runs via the Moventool migrator; never write directly to a shard during a move. Lookups go through the router, not node endpoints. Shard map lives in the Hollis config service. Rebalance alerts page the data crew, not you. Read the runbook before touching anything. Access to the shard-map admin console requires the recovery passphrase appended below.

vault phrase of fahog-yajog = frawyn-jordor-casael-gormir-olieth-julmir